首页 | 本学科首页   官方微博 | 高级检索  
     

基于社交关系和用户偏好的多样性图推荐方法
引用本文:石进平,李劲,和凤珍.基于社交关系和用户偏好的多样性图推荐方法[J].计算机科学,2018,45(Z6):423-427.
作者姓名:石进平  李劲  和凤珍
作者单位:云南大学软件学院 昆明 650091;云南省软件工程重点实验室 昆明 650091,云南大学软件学院 昆明 650091;云南省软件工程重点实验室 昆明 650091,云南大学旅游文化学院信科系 云南 丽江674199
基金项目:本文受国家自然科学基金项目(61562091),云南省应用基础研究计划面上项目(2016FB110),云南省软件工程重点实验室开放项目(2012SE303,2SE205)资助
摘    要:以协同过滤为代表的传统推荐算法能够为用户提供准确率较高的推荐列表,但忽略了推荐系统中另外一个重要的衡量标准:多样性。随着社交网络的日益发展,大量冗余和重复的信息充斥其间,信息过载使得快速、有效地发现用户的兴趣爱好变得更加困难。针对某个用户推荐最能满足其兴趣爱好的物品,需要具备显著的相关度且能覆盖用户广泛的兴趣爱好。因此,基于社交关系和用户偏好提出一种面向多样性和相关度的图排序框架。首先,引入社交关系图模型,综合考虑用户及物品之间的关系,以更好地建模它们的相关度;然后,利用线性模型融合多样性和相关性两个重要指标;最后,利用Spark GraphX并行图计算框架实现该算法,并在真实的数据集上通过实验验证所提方法的有效性和扩展性。

关 键 词:多样性  相关性  社交网络  个性化推荐系统  Spark  GraphX

Diversity Recommendation Approach Based on Social Relationship and User Preference
SHI Jin-ping,LI Jin and HE Feng-zhen.Diversity Recommendation Approach Based on Social Relationship and User Preference[J].Computer Science,2018,45(Z6):423-427.
Authors:SHI Jin-ping  LI Jin and HE Feng-zhen
Affiliation:School of Software,Yunnan University,Kunming 650091,China;Key Laboratory of Software Engineering of Yunnan Province,Kunming 650091,China,School of Software,Yunnan University,Kunming 650091,China;Key Laboratory of Software Engineering of Yunnan Province,Kunming 650091,China and Department of Information and Science,College of Tourism and Culture,Yunnan University,Lijiang,Yunnan 674199,China
Abstract:The traditional recommendation algorithm,represented by collaborative filtering,can provide users with a high recommended list with high accuracy,while ignoring another important measure which is diversity in the recommendation system.With the increasing development of social networks,with a lot of redundancy and duplication of information,the overload information makes it more difficult to find user interests quickly and effectively.For recommending the most content for users to meet their hobbies, user interests with a significant relevance and covering different aspects are needed.Therefore,based on social relations and user preferences,this paper proposed a sorting framework for diversity and relevance.Firstly,this paper introduced the social relations graph model,considering the relationship between users and items to better model their relevance.Then,this paper used a linear model to integrate the two important indexes of diversity and relevance.Finally,the algorithm was implemented by Spark GraphX parallel graph calculation framework,and experiments were carried on real dataset to verify the feasibility and scalability of the proposed algorithm.
Keywords:Diversity  Relevance  Social network  Personalized recommendation system  Spark GraphX
点击此处可从《计算机科学》浏览原始摘要信息
点击此处可从《计算机科学》下载全文
设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号